St Peter’s Church, Evercreech
Church
Photo: mym,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Church of St Peter in Evercreech, Somerset, England, dates from the 14th century and is a Grade I listed building. The three-stage tower has set-back buttresses ascending to pinnacles, with a very tall transomed two-light bell-chamber with windows on each face The embattled parapet has quatrefoil piercing, with big corner pinnacles and smaller intermediate pinnacles. Church of St Mary Magdalene
Church
Photo: Barbara Voules,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Church of St Mary Magdalene is the Church of England parish church for the village of Ditcheat, Somerset, England. There has been a church on the site since 824, and the present building owes much of its grandeur to the Abbots of Glastonbury. Church of St James
Church
Photo: Phil Williams,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Anglican Church of St James in Milton Clevedon, within the English county of Somerset, was rebuilt in 1790. It is a Grade II* listed building. The first church in the village was in the 12th century. Church of St James is situated 1½ miles east of Brookfield Farm.
